pages20

Как организованы платформы обработки инцидентов в реальном времени

Как организованы платформы обработки инцидентов в реальном времени

Платформы обработки происшествий в реальном времени представляют собой набор программных компонентов, которые принимают, анализируют и обрабатывают последовательности данных с минимальной отсрочкой. Такие механизмы функционируют непрерывно, гарантируя быструю реакцию на поступающую данные.

Базу архитектуры образуют три основных составляющих: источники происшествий, обработчики и базы данных. Источники создают беспрерывный последовательность сведений через выделенные интерфейсы. Обработчики выполняют селекцию, трансформацию и агрегацию данных согласно заданным принципам.

Нынешние платформы задействуют распределённую архитектуру для гарантирования большой производительности. Входящие события распределяются между набором серверов обработки, что дает cabura casino масштабироваться горизонтально и преобразовывать миллионы событий в секунду.

Критическим показателем служит время ответа — промежуток между приемом инцидента и формированием результата. Эффективные системы обрабатывают сведения за миллисекунды, что критично для финансовых операций и механизмов безопасности.

Источники происшествий: измерители, приложения, логи, операции и пользовательские манипуляции

События приходят в комплекс из многообразных источников, каждый из которых создает специфический тип данных. Сенсоры индустриального техники посылают показатели температуры, давления, вибрации и прочих физических параметров с периодичностью до сотен измерений в секунду.

Веб-приложения и мобильные решения формируют происшествия при взаимодействии пользователя с интерфейсом. Щелчки, посещения страниц, добавление изделий образуют постоянный поток деятельности. Серверные программы регистрируют вызовы к API и изменения состояния подключений.

Системные логи отслеживают технические инциденты: сбои, предупреждения, информационные оповещения о функционировании инфраструктуры. Специальные службы накапливают записи с серверов и контейнеров, передавая их в cabura для объединенной обработки.

Экономические операции генерируют критически значимые события при операциях и оплатах. Банковские механизмы производят данные о каждой транзакции с картой и корректировке остатка. Торговые решения отслеживают заявки на приобретение и продажу активов.

Построение поточной обслуживания

Потоковая обработка строится на основе постоянного перемещения данных через последовательность модулей без временного записи. Происшествия проходят через череду изменений, где каждый компонент производит определённую роль: селекцию, дополнение, объединение или направление.

Базовая архитектура содержит слой принятия данных, который принимает инциденты из сторонних источников и конвертирует их в единообразный формат. Очередной ярус реализует бизнес-логику: рассчитывает метрики, обнаруживает нарушения, использует правила обработки. Результаты отправляются в ярус вывода для записи или пересылки.

Нынешние системы обеспечивают два варианта к обработке. Первый обрабатывает каждое инцидент индивидуально тотчас после приема. Второй объединяет происшествия в минипакеты и преобразует их с периодом в несколько секунд. Определение зависит от запросов к латентности и количеству данных.

Части построения взаимодействуют через стандартизированные соединения, что обеспечивает менять определенные части без перестройки всей платформы. кабура обеспечивает гибкость при корректировке критериев.

Очереди и шины данных: как инциденты передаются между сервисами

Пересылка инцидентов между частями структуры производится через специализированные средства транспортировки уведомлениями. Очереди сообщений обеспечивают надёжную транспортировку данных от источников к получателям с обеспечением целостности при авариях.

Каналы данных представляют собой децентрализованные решения для публикации и получения на массивы происшествий. Источники направляют данные в обозначенные каналы, а получатели регистрируются на необходимые категории. Такая схема позволяет единственному инциденту охватывать набора получателей параллельно.

Главные свойства систем отправки событий охватывают:

  • Пропускную производительность — количество сообщений в период времени
  • Задержку транспортировки — время между передачей и приемом
  • Гарантии транспортировки — степень стабильности доставки
  • Очередность — сохранение цепочки происшествий

Инструменты буферизации сохраняют происшествия при временной неготовности получателей. cabura хранит данные на накопителе до instant завершенной преобразования. Копирование между серверами предотвращает исчезновение данных при аварии машин.

Подходы обработки

Комплексы реального времени задействуют различные модели обработки инцидентов в обусловленности от бизнес-требований и характера данных. Каждая схема описывает принцип объединения, исследования и конвертации поступающих массивов.

Обработка единичных инцидентов изучает каждое данные автономно от прочих. Механизм применяет правила фильтрации и обогащения к каждой записи тотчас после приема. Такой вариант сокращает задержки и применим для существенных сценариев с условием быстрой ответа.

Временная преобразование собирает инциденты по временным периодам или числу элементов. Механизм сохраняет данные в протяжение определённого периода, далее реализует объединение и определение статистики. Периоды могут быть статичными, динамичными или сеансовыми в связи от правил программы.

Обработка с удержанием статуса удерживает связь между инцидентами. Механизм запоминает временные итоги, счётчики, аккумулированные величины для будущих вычислений. кабура казино применяет распределённое базу для обеспечения целостности. Модель без статуса преобразует происшествия изолированно, что упрощает увеличение.

Размещение данных: активные (real-time) и долгосрочные (архивные) уровни

Структура сохранения данных в механизмах реального времени делится на несколько слоев в связи от частоты обращения и запросов к быстроте получения. Такое разделение оптимизирует расходы и предоставляет равновесие между скоростью и расходами.

Горячий уровень содержит актуальные сведения, к которым требуется моментальный обращение. Сведения размещается в рабочей ОЗУ или на быстрых SSD-дисках для уменьшения времени отклика. Базы этого яруса обрабатывают тысячи запросов в секунду. Промежуток размещения составляет от нескольких часов до нескольких дней.

Промежуточный слой содержит информацию среднего периода для анализа и документирования. Инциденты транспортируются сюда автоматом после окончания срока свежести. кабура предоставляет равновесие между быстротой запроса и емкостью размещения.

Архивный архивный слой предназначен для долгосрочного размещения прошлых сведений. Данные хранится на недорогих накопителях с низкоскоростным обращением. Хранилища применяются для выполнения нормам контролеров, аудита и изучения паттернов. Срок размещения может доходить нескольких лет.

Увеличение и живучесть

Возможность системы обрабатывать растущие количества данных и поддерживать функциональность при авариях устанавливает её стабильность в рабочей обстановке. Структура должна предусматривать инструменты горизонтального роста и резервации критичных элементов.

Горизонтальное увеличение подключает новые узлы обработки при повышении трафика. Происшествия автоматически делятся между готовыми узлами в соответствии методам балансировки. Комплекс динамически приспосабливается к корректировке массива данных без прерывания.

Инструменты достижения отказоустойчивости cabura включают:

  • Копирование данных между серверами для исключения потерь
  • Автоматическое смену на альтернативные элементы при аварии
  • Промежуточные моменты для фиксации состояния обработки
  • Реставрация с возобновлением с крайнего записанного состояния

Балансировка трафика выполняется на фундаменте ключей сегментации, которые определяют маршрутизацию происшествий к процессорам. кабура казино обеспечивает упорядоченную обработку связанных происшествий на единственном компоненте. Контроль здоровья серверов позволяет определять снижение скорости и перераспределять операции.

Контроль и алертинг: как контролируют положение потоков и реагируют на нарушения

Постоянное контроль за состоянием платформы обработки событий позволяет обнаруживать трудности до их существенного воздействия на рабочие процессы. Системы контроля собирают метрики эффективности и создают оповещения при вариациях от нормальных показателей.

Главные параметры включают скорость прихода событий, отсрочку обработки, объем очередей и процент ошибок. Комплексы наблюдают нагрузку процессоров, эксплуатацию памяти и дискового объема на узлах группы. Чарты демонстрируют динамику параметров в реальном времени.

Пороговые параметры задают границы штатного работы для каждой метрики. При выходе пределов система автоматически создает предупреждения для специалистов. кабура позволяет конфигурировать правила уведомления с учетом значимости различных типов инцидентов.

Анализ аномалий применяет математические подходы для выявления нестандартных закономерностей в потоках данных. Процедуры выявляют резкие всплески загрузки, нестандартные череды происшествий, странную поведение. Автоматизированные отклики охватывают расширение мощностей, смену на дублирующие каналы или ограничение приходящего трафика.

Случаи эксплуатации комплексов обработки инцидентов

Денежные учреждения используют комплексы обработки событий для определения фальшивых операций. Алгоритмы исследуют каждую действие по карте в instant проведения, сравнивая с прошлыми паттернами активности заказчика. При нахождении подозрительной активности механизм отклоняет операцию за миллисекунды.

Интернет-магазины используют поточную обработку для индивидуализации предложений изделий. Происшествия обзора страниц, включения в корзину и покупок обрабатываются в реальном времени. Комплекс формирует актуальные предложения на фундаменте настоящего поведения пользователя.

Производственные заводы устанавливают мониторинг оборудования для предиктивного сервиса. Датчики на заводских конвейерах отправляют величины дрожания, температуры и потребления электричества. кабура казино анализирует информацию и предсказывает возможные сбои, что дает проектировать ремонт без непредвиденных простоев.

Перевозочные предприятия отслеживают транспортировку посылок и оптимизируют пути доставки. GPS-трекеры формируют позиции перевозочных средств каждые несколько секунд. Комплекс рассматривает затруднения и неотложность заказов для динамической корректировки траекторий и оповещения заказчиков о времени доставки.

Schreibe einen Kommentar

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ind mit * markiert